Ingredients

1 large louisiana sweet potato
2 ounces cane syrup
4 ounces cream cheese
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1 tablespoon cinnamon
1/2 nut nutmeg , grated with microplane
1 cup pecans , coarsely chopped
1 cup unsalted butter
1 cup honey
8 slices hearty white bread or 4 slices thick-sliced challah
2 egg yolks
2 tablespoons brown sugar
1 tablespoon cinnamon
1/2 nut nutmeg , grated
1 tablespoon vanilla
1 teaspoon kosher salt
2 tablespoons unsalted butter , melted
1 cup milk
1/2 tablespoon unsalted butter
Louisiana Sweet Potato French Toast With Pecan Honey-Butter is a delicious twist on classic French toast. This breakfast dish is made with thick slices of bread that are coated in a sweet potato and cream cheese mixture. The sweet potato adds a subtle sweetness and a creamy texture to the dish, while the cream cheese gives it a smooth richness that pairs perfectly with the pecan honey-butter sauce. This dish is perfect for a lazy Sunday morning with friends and family or a special brunch occasion.

Instructions

1.Preheat the oven to 350°F.
2.Bake the sweet potato until tender, about 40 minutes.
3.In a large bowl, whisk together the cane syrup, cream cheese, kosher salt, cinnamon, and nutmeg until well-combined.
4.Add the chopped pecans to the bowl and stir to combine.
5.In a medium saucepan, melt the unsalted butter over low heat.
6.Add the honey to the saucepan and stir to combine.
7.Cut the sweet potato into small pieces and add it to the bowl with the pecans and cream cheese mixture. Stir to combine.
8.In a separate bowl, whisk together the egg yolks, brown sugar, cinnamon, nutmeg, vanilla, kosher salt, melted unsalted butter, and milk until smooth.
9.Spread the sweet potato mixture over one side of each slice of bread.
10.Dip each slice of bread into the egg mixture, coating both sides well.
11.Melt 1/2 tablespoon of unsalted butter in a nonstick skillet over medium heat.
12.Add the bread slices to the skillet and cook until golden brown, about 2-3 minutes per side.
13.Serve the French toast warm, topped with the pecan honey-butter sauce.

HEALTH & BENEFITS

Sweet potatoes are full of vitamins and fiber.
They are particularly high in beta carotene, which is a potent antioxidant that helps to protect the body against disease.
Pecans are a good source of healthy fats and protein.
They are also high in fiber and micronutrients like magnesium and zinc.
